Texas A&M AgriLife Research is seeking candidates for a full-time Assistant Research Scientist (R-050678) at their Weslaco Center in Weslaco, Texas. 

Texas A&M AgriLife Research is the leading research and technology development agency in Texas for agriculture, natural resources, and the life sciences. Our discoveries yield economic, environmental, and health benefits that are key to our state’s success and vital to the lives of its citizens.  AgriLife Research ranks among the top U.S. agricultural research entities with more than 500 initiatives each year in agriculture, natural resources, and life sciences. Our statewide research presence is headquartered in College Station — a central hub for collaboration with scientists and research staff at Texas A&M University System campuses and 13 regional Texas A&M AgriLife Research and Extension Centers across Texas.  For more information on The Texas A&M AgriLife Research, please visit https://agriliferesearch.tamu.edu

The Texas A&M AgriLife Research & Extension Center in Weslaco houses faculty from a variety of research and extension programs, including breeding and genetics, plant biochemistry, plant pathology, horticulture, economics, range science, wildfire, and 4-H. For more information on The Texas A&M AgriLife Research & Extension Center in Weslaco, please visit https://weslaco.tamu.edu

The City of Weslaco is a city in Hidalgo County, Texas, United States. As of the 2010 census the population was 35,670, and in 2018 the estimated population was 41,171. It is located at the southern tip of Texas in the Rio Grande Valley near the Mexican border, across the Rio Grande from the city of Nuevo Progreso, Rio Bravo, Tamaulipas.  For more information on the City of Weslaco, please visit https://www.weslacotx.gov

ESSENTIAL DUTIES:  

Responsible for design, completion, and analysis of large-scale DNA/RNA sequencing, and metagenome studies. Prepare progress reports and manuscripts for publication and conferences and assist in writing grant proposals. Train lab personnel and organize genomics/bioinformatics training workshops as required. 

SUPERVISION: Kranthi Mandadi 

EDUCATION:  

Required: Ph.D., in genomics, bioinformatics, computational biology, or closely related field. 

Preferred: Demonstrated experience in plant genomics/bioinformatics. 

EXPERIENCE 

  • Experience with the latest NGS-based plant genome/transcriptome sequencing, assembly, annotation, differential gene expression, and network analysis tools, genotyping by sequencing, genome-wide association studies, and metagenomics analyses 
  • Record of high-impact publications in genomics and bioinformatics research.  

KNOWLEDGE, ABILITIES, AND SKILLS: 

Required:   

  • Significant level of bioinformatics skills using open-source bioinformatics tools and proficiency with the latest NGS data analysis packages in R/Bioconductor, etc. 
  • Proficiency in programming with R or Python 
  • Strong written and oral communication skills, ability to multitask and work cooperatively with others.  

Preferred:   

  • Working knowledge of plant genetics and experience with complex crop genomes. 
  • Working knowledge of scripting languages such as Python, Unix Shell, etc. 
  • Experience with reproducible data analysis platforms such as Nextflow and GitHub 
  • Ability to demonstrate complex results both verbally and in writing 
  • Excellent communication skills and ability to translate bioinformatics knowledge into biological insights.
